Features
April 2006
3V to 3.6V Low Voltage in Read Operation
Access Time: 100 ns
Byte-wide or Word-wide Configurable
16 Mbit Mask ROM Replacement
Low Power Consumption
– Active Current: 30 mA at 8 MHz
– Standby Current: 60 µA
Programming Voltage: 12.5V ± 0.25V
Programming Time: 50 µs/word
Electronic Signature
– Manufacturer Code: 20h
– Device Code: B1h
ECOPACK® packages available

M27V160 1 Summary description The M27V160 is a low voltage 16 Mbit EPROM offered in the two ranges UV (ultra violet erase) and OTP (one time programmable ideally suited for microprocessor systems requiring large data or program storage organised as either 2 Mbit words of 8 bit or 1 Mbit words of 16 bit. The pin-out is compatible with a 16 Mbit Mask ROM. ...

M27V160 can be programmed as the M27C160 on the same programming equipments applying 12.75V on V When delivered (and after each erasure for UV EPROM), all bits of the M27V160 are in the '1' state. Data is introduced by selectively programming '0's to the desired bit locations. Although only '0's will be programmed, both '1's and '0's can be present in the data word. ...

Research shows that constant exposure to room level fluorescent lighting could erase a typical M27V160 in about 3 years, while it would take approximately 1 week to cause erasure when exposed to direct sunlight. If the M27V160 exposed to these types of lighting conditions for extended periods of time suggested that opaque labels be put over the M27V160 window to prevent unintentional erasure ...
